Graph Theory has grown into a major area of Discrete Mathematics with applications in a wide variety of fields: Computer Science, Coding Theory, Cryptography, Electrical Engineering, Sociology, Psychology, Physics, Chemistry, Economics, etc. It also provides a premier interdisciplinary platform for researchers to present and discuss the most recent innovations as well as practical challenges encountered in the field of Graph Theory. In the proposed conference, we have planned to conduct a symposium on graph decompositions. Graph decompositions have a wide variety of applications such as computer architecture, designing reliable communication networks. Hypercubes, Butterfly network, and de Bruijn network are proved to be good interconnection networks.
